Briefly

A quick rundown on the latest news from the IRS.
Sorry, we're closed. But, for the 6 to 7 million people who still need to file their tax returns, they're still due October 15th. And, if you owe any money, you should definitely mail that in. No one will be here to open the envelope, but mail it in anyway.
Speaking of people being here, we won't be so don't call if you need any help with your taxes. If you can't get all the information you need, you'll just have to do the best you can because, hey, we already gave you an extra six months to file. What else do you want?
Oh, a refund? Can't do. We're leaving the computers on that handle electronically filed returns but the one that issues refunds electronically was sent home. And paper checks? Don't make me laugh.
But it's not all bad news, people with appointments related to audits, collection, Appeals or Taxpayer Advocate cases should assume their meetings are cancelled. That is, appointments with people. But the computer that automatically sends nasty-grams, that's still here so you might get one of those. Which, of course, we expect you to respond to in a a timely manner.
So, have a nice day and remember to wish us a Happy Birthday!
Okay, so I paraphrased a little. But the IRS didn't have to work all weekend.
